  17. HiAt this point in time you will be unable to do a manual departure - one of the many bugs which are being attended to.What should happen is this. Manual departure - A/T set to ON - F/D off. Set thrust. At Vr rotate. Then when the AP is engaged, pitch mode (VS) and lateral mode (HDG/ATT) SHOULD engage. At the moment this does not happen.So the bottom line is that until another lot of fixes come through, you are going to have to use VNAV or FLCH and LNAV for all your flights.You will also notice that the F/D does not work correctly. After T/O it should command the pitch for V2 + 10 - it doesn't - another bug.As far as SIDS and STARS are concerned, I recommend that you download the latest AIRAC cycle from Navigraph / Navdata(801). This has all the SIDS and STARS included. Use the cycle for PIC/PMDG - this one works in the iFly FMC.As far as the roll rate is concerned, I am currently working on the FDE but I think this is actually a gauge programming issue. I have already illiminated the pitch sensitivity issue on T/O and climb out.At some point (????) we'll have killed all the bugs - then it will be a case of sit back and enjoy the ride!Trevor
